Went to this Panera over off of Maple for a lunch meeting. One of the bigger Panera Restaurants I have seen. They even have a glass enclosed room that can be reserved for special events. Had people in there today playing cards. The area to order is a bit more narrow than other Panera’s I have experienced. So narrow, that it is easy for people to get backed up and not realize what is going on. Cashier who took order was pleasant. Went for the new Thai Garden Chicken Wonton Broth Bowl. Bowl comes with ginger-chicken wontons, fresh broccoli, spinach, napa cabbage blend, roasted mushroom and onion blend and Thai chili vinaigrette with cilantro and sesame seeds in a broth. Broth bowl was okay, but I really miss the Soba Noodle Bowl that was on the previous menu. I will not be ordering this particular bowl again. Just did not appeal to me. Plenty of space to sit down and spread out.
